A meaningful place in my daily routine

“I chose the S. Walter Stewart Library because it quickly became a meaningful place in my daily routine when I was working as a nanny. It was welcoming, accessible, and offered a warm environment where the children could explore, learn, and feel a sense of independence. Spending so much time there helped me understand how important this library is to the surrounding community. It isn’t just a building with books, it’s a vibrant hub where families gather, children discover new interests, and neighbors connect through the many programs offered and shared spaces.

People often described the library as friendly, bright, and inviting, especially the children’s section, which always felt lively and full of possibility. The kids I cared for saw it as a place of fun and curiosity, while parents appreciated it as a dependable, supportive resource.

To me, the S. Walter Stewart Library represents comfort, growth, and connection. It holds years of memories, quiet reading sessions, excited discoveries, and moments that brought me closer to the children and the community. “

Submitted by Kristie, S. Walter Stewart
